H-7 continued POST Error Messages continued 1785 Slot 1 Drive Array not Configured (followed by one of the following:) (1) Run Compaq Array Configuration Utility. (2) No drives detected. (3) Array Accelerator Memory Size Increased. (4) External Cable(s) Attached to Wrong SCSI Port Connector(s). (5) Drive positions cannot be changed during Capacity Expansion. (6) Drive positions appear to have changed. (7) Configuration information indicates drive positions beyond the capability of this controller. This may be due to drive movement from a controller that supports more drives than the current controller. (8) Configuration information indicates drives were configured on a controller with a newer firmware version. (1) Run the Compaq Array Configuration Utility. (2) Turn off system and check SCSI cable connections to make sure drives are attached properly. (3) Run the Compaq System Configuration Utility. (4) Turn system power OFF and swap SCSI port connectors to prevent data loss. (5-6) Run Drive Array Advanced Diagnostics if previous positions are unknown. Then turn system power OFF and move drives to their original positions. (7) To avoid data loss turn system power OFF and reattach drives to the original controller. (8) To avoid data loss, reattach drives to original controller or upgrade controller firmware to the version on the original controller using Option ROMPaq. Select F1 key to resume. 1786 Slot x Drive Array Recovery Needed. The following SCSI drive(s) need Automatic Data Recovery: SCSI Port (y): SCSI ID (x) Select F1 to continue with recovery of data to drive. Select F2 to continue without recovery of data to drive. Or Slot x Drive Array Recovery Needed. The following SCSI drive(s) need Automatic Data Recovery: SCSI Port (y): SCSI ID (x) Select F1 to retry Automatic Data Recovery Select F2 to continue without starting Automatic Data Recovery. The message normally appears when a drive was replaced in a fault-tolerant configuration with system power off. In this case, press F1 to start the automatic data recovery process. The "previously aborted" version of the 1786 POST message will appear if the previous rebuild attempt was aborted for any reason. Run Drive Array Advanced Diagnostics (DAAD) for more information. If the replacement drive was failed, try using another replacement drive. If rebuild was aborted due to a read error from another physical drive in the array, you'll need to back up all readable data on the array, run Diagnostics Surface Analysis, and then restore your data. 1787 Slot x Drive Array Operating in Interim Following a system restart, this message Recovery Mode.
